> This is V2 of the smsc911x fifo byteswap patch.
> 
> The smsc911x hardware supports both big and little and endian
> hardware configurations, and the linux smsc911x driver currently
> detects word order.
> 
> For correct operation on big endian platforms lacking swapped
> byte lanes the following patch is needed. Only fifo data is
> swapped, register data does not require any swapping.
